JaneO 15 Posted June 25, 2017 Pain gets better. I promise! I am 20 days post op and feel great. Around day 14 pain gets much better. I can take very big sips of Water, eat yogurt and very soft eggs with no issues. Headache could be from the narcotic. Try straight Tylenol. Also look into getting a belly binder. It helps keep those muscles tight so you don't have to. Ice packs also feel good. Stay focused on the end game. It's worth it! 2 Lifeisgreatwith4 and LaRein reacted to this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
